i try to write a socket which loads programs and redirects socket io to these. sounds much like inetd but as far as i know, inetd loads the program when its port is requested. i want to have it loaded permanently.
so far so good. writing a socket server is not that tricky but i didn't get the rest working. I basically want to open a pipe(), dup2() it to stdin and stdout and execv() my program.
the problem is, that my called program doesn't get any input.I'll try to show it with a test program. can someone tell me, what's wrong?
int create_program_fork(int *ios, char const *program) {
// create pipes to program
if (pipe(ios) != 0) {
return -1;
}
// fork to new process
int f = fork();
if (f < 0) {
// fork didn't work
close(ios[0]);
close(ios[1]);
return(-1);
}
if (f > 0) {
// master hasn't much to do here
return f;
}
// *** Child Process
// close std** file descriptors
printf ("executing program");
close(STDIN_FILENO);
close(STDOUT_FILENO);
// duplicate pipes as std**
dup2(ios[0], STDIN_FILENO);
dup2(ios[1], STDOUT_FILENO);
// close pipes
close(ios[0]);
close(ios[1]);
// call program
return execvp(program, NULL );
}
int main(int argc, char *argv[]) {
int ios[2];
// call program
int pid = create_program_fork(ios, "/bin/bash");
if (0 != pid){
exit(EXIT_FAILURE);
}
char const exit_order[] = "exit\0";
char const order[] = ">/tmp/test.txt\0";
// do something
write(ios[1], order, strlen(order));
// bash should stop then..
write(ios[1], exit_order, strlen(exit_order));
return 0;
}
